    Kessler late ko

    Kessler is the bigger, stronger man.

    He has better skills and a better workrate and variety.

    Kessler would break Abraham down, and around the mid rounds start sitting down on his punches and he would get rid of Arthur in around 10.

    Obviously it wouldnt be as simple or as easy as that but i think Kessler is way to good for Abraham.
